PRODUCT DESIGN LEAD – DESIGN SYSTEMS SPECIALIST

An exciting opportunity for a seasoned Product Designer with a passion for design systems and UI optimisation to lead the charge in shaping a unified, scalable experience for a well-established SaaS platform. This fully remote role sits within a high-performing squad focused on improving performance, scalability, and user experience, and offers the chance to build something truly foundational that impacts the wider mission-driven tech business.

What they need

  • A design lead who’s evolved into design ops and systems work, with hands-on experience owning scalable component libraries
  • Someone who thrives in messy environments, who can wrangle inconsistency, spot inefficiencies and build order through design
  • A designer with strong product fundamentals, who can define core UX patterns and make confident decisions that balance short-term improvement and long-term vision
  • Someone collaborative, confident working day-to-day with senior engineers and product partners to make sure systems are implemented and adopted successfully
  • A detail-obsessed UI specialist, motivated by the small stuff and driven to create a cohesive design language that scales

What you're great at

  • You're a systems thinker and Figma expert, skilled in building scalable component libraries, streamlining UI patterns, ensuring accessibility, and partnering closely with engineers to implement consistent, efficient design solutions
  • Building and maintaining component libraries in Figma, with experience linking these to real components
  • Leading UI audits, pattern consolidation and design clean-up, driving consistency across complex product surfaces
  • Collaborating with front-end engineers to implement and refine system components across platforms
  • Working in agile teams alongside some exceptional PMs & engineers to establish a cohesive design language

What you'll get

  • Full remote flexibility from anywhere in the UK with occasional team meetups/travel
